Publisher's Synopsis

A cup of inspiration, a dash of understanding, and a generous serving of wisdom for writers new and old. From the desk of writer and editor Deborah J. Ross comes a collection of warm, insightful essays on the writing life: including getting started, negotiating with the Idea Fairy and creating memorable characters, writing queries, surviving bad reviews, dealing with life's interruptions, confronting creative jealousy, and nourishing yourself and your creative muse. Contains space for personal notes.
